Limoncello Lemon Slushie

Tart and sweet simple syrup poured over shaved ice - this Limoncello Lemon Slushie is the ultimate summer refresher.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time10 minutes
Chill Time2 hours
Total Time2 hours 25 minutes
Course: Drinks
Cuisine: American
Servings: 6 servings
Calories: 142kcal

Ingredients

  • 1 cup sugar
  • 3 cups water
  • 1.5 cups fresh squeezed lemon juice about 6-7 large lemons
  • snow cone Ice
  • zest of 2 lemons

Instructions

  • In a pan combine 1 cup water, 1.5 cups lemon juice and 1 cup sugar. Bring to a boil and stir till sugar is dissolved. Remove from heat, and transfer to pitcher. Add remaining water, and allow sugar syrup to cool to room temperature.
  • Using a lemon peel zester, zest two lemons and put into syrup.
  • Allow to marinate for a few hours up to days in refrigerator. 
  • Fill your blendtec canister with ice, crush using ice crush setting so ice turns to a fluffy snow like consistency.
  • Fill cups with "snow"
  • Pour over ice the limoncello syrup
